How does South Point, OH compare to Sherwood, OH? South Point has a population of 3,228 with a median household income of $80,689, while Sherwood has 3,259 residents and a median income of $132,653.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| South Point, OH | Sherwood, OH |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 3,228 | 3,259 | -1.0% |
| Median Age | 45 | 49.9 | -9.8% |
| Foreign Born % | 1.1% | 6.4% | -82.8% |
| Metric | South Point | Sherwood |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$80,689 | $132,653 | -39.2% |
| Unemployment | 1.7% | 5.3% | -67.9% |
| Poverty Rate | 8.1% | 2.1% | +285.7% |
| Bachelor's+ | 21.2% | 58.3% | -63.6% |
| Metric | South Point | Sherwood |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$175,200 | $273,900 | -36.0% |
| Median Rent | $807/mo | $774/mo | +4.3% |
| Housing Units | 1,439 | 1,494 | -3.7% |
